  17. SmurfK

    SmurfK Member

    Stirling Sharp Dressed Man

    Got a sample, and, my impression would probably not be liked by many people.
    It is an ok performer. Easy enough to lather, not spectacular, slick enough. I'm ok with that, having in mind the price. Was not expecting nothing spectacular. Not the best performer for the price, but not the worse. On my face, managed to produce an allergic reaction. Burning sensation right from first application. Managed to use it once. Used it yesterday, for a single painful pass, tried it again today, but did not went with shaving, just washed it off.
    Scent is not spectacular. I must say that i never smelled Creed Irish Tweed. Anyway, this soaps smells like generic summer/fresh cologne. It might be nice to find that kind of fragrance in shaving soap simply because they are not many with those kind of smell, but, i also get an odd smell around it, like plastic or something around those lines. Can't put my finger on it, but i don't like it at all.

    Performance - 7/10
    Scent - 3/10
